Скрыть объявление
Гость отличная новость! Мы открыли доступ к ранее скрытому контенту.

Вам доступно более 44 000 видео уроков, книг и программ без VIP статуса. Более подробно ЗДЕСЬ.

Архив Python. Уровень 3. Разработка веб - приложений в Django

Тема в разделе "Неактивные складчины (архив)", создана пользователем InfoNews, 20 май 2014.

0/5, Голосов: 0

  1. InfoNews

    InfoNews Модератор

    Сообщения:
    17.814
    Симпатии:
    27.327
    [​IMG]
    Цель курса: изучить создание веб-приложений на языке Python с использованием MVC-подхода на примере фреймворка Django.

    Курс предназначен для программистов, интересующихся веб-разработкой, возможно, имеющих определенный практический опыт разработки с использованием РНР и СУБД.

    Страница курса - http://www.specialist.ru/course/python3

    Спойлер: Программа курса
    Модуль 1. Web-разработка с применением концепции MVC
    История и развитие веб-программирования, различные подходы.
    Идеи MVC-подхода: разделение логики, интерфейса и данных.
    Установка Web-фреймворка Django.
    Структура проекта.

    Модуль 2. Основы использования шаблонов
    Передача данных из приложения в шаблоны.
    Использование циклов и выбора в шаблонах.

    Модуль 3. Хранение и работа с данными
    Способы хранения данных
    Создание и администрирование БД.
    Схема БД: таблицы, связи между ними, ключи.
    Отображение данных в БД на объекты приложения (ORM).
    Реализация операций выборки, создания, удаления и изменения объектов.

    Модуль 4. Использование форм
    Специальные средства создания форм.
    Проверка параметров форм.

    Модуль 5. Разграничение прав доступа пользователей
    Авторизация пользователей и разграничение прав доступа.
    Сессии, не требующие регистрации.
    Безопасность.

    Модуль 6. Сложные запросы к данным
    Реализация сложных запросов.
    Соединение запросов, подзапросы.
    Вызов хранимых процедур.

    Модуль 7. Расширенные возможности шаблонного механизма
    Встроенные фильтры.
    Создание своих фильтров.

    Модуль 8. Выдача данных в форматах, отличных от HTML
    Отделение статического контента от динамического.
    Отправка почтовых уведомлений.
    Отдача лент новостей.
    Генерация PDF-документов

    Модуль 9. Средства отладки и тестирования
    Журналирование.
    Встроенный интерфейс администрирования.
    Модульное тестирование.

    Модуль 10. Развертывание веб-приложений
    Использование встроенного веб-сервера, CGI, FastCGI и mod_python.
    Развертывание и миграция БД.
    Спойлер
    Стоимость вебинара - 9 490 рублей. Записываемся в список и выбираем организатора

    Список:
    Спойлер
    01.timofeev90
     
Сохранить в соц. сетях:
Оценить эту тему:
/5,